comparison tests/test-evolve-obshistory.t @ 3360:1905aac253f0

test: update output to 02fdb8c018aa Now that we have directaccess in core, we get a new warning message when updating to a hidden changeset. Update the tests. CORE-TEST-OUTPUT-UPDATE: 02fdb8c018aa
author Boris Feld <boris.feld@octobus.net>
date Fri, 05 Jan 2018 09:51:07 +0100
parents ae6fddf39933
children 1cb549cd6236
comparison
equal deleted inserted replaced
3359:ae6fddf39933 3360:1905aac253f0
176 $ hg update 471f378eab4c 176 $ hg update 471f378eab4c
177 abort: hidden revision '471f378eab4c'! 177 abort: hidden revision '471f378eab4c'!
178 (use --hidden to access hidden revisions; successor: 4ae3a4151de9) 178 (use --hidden to access hidden revisions; successor: 4ae3a4151de9)
179 [255] 179 [255]
180 $ hg update --hidden "desc(A0)" 180 $ hg update --hidden "desc(A0)"
181 updating to a hidden changeset 471f378eab4c
181 1 files updated, 0 files merged, 0 files removed, 0 files unresolved 182 1 files updated, 0 files merged, 0 files removed, 0 files unresolved
182 working directory parent is obsolete! (471f378eab4c) 183 working directory parent is obsolete! (471f378eab4c)
183 (use 'hg evolve' to update to its successor: 4ae3a4151de9) 184 (use 'hg evolve' to update to its successor: 4ae3a4151de9)
184 185
185 Test output with pruned commit 186 Test output with pruned commit
276 $ hg up 0dec01379d3b 277 $ hg up 0dec01379d3b
277 abort: hidden revision '0dec01379d3b'! 278 abort: hidden revision '0dec01379d3b'!
278 (use --hidden to access hidden revisions; pruned) 279 (use --hidden to access hidden revisions; pruned)
279 [255] 280 [255]
280 $ hg up --hidden -r 'desc(B0)' 281 $ hg up --hidden -r 'desc(B0)'
282 updating to a hidden changeset 0dec01379d3b
281 1 files updated, 0 files merged, 0 files removed, 0 files unresolved 283 1 files updated, 0 files merged, 0 files removed, 0 files unresolved
282 working directory parent is obsolete! (0dec01379d3b) 284 working directory parent is obsolete! (0dec01379d3b)
283 (use 'hg evolve' to update to its parent successor) 285 (use 'hg evolve' to update to its parent successor)
284 286
285 Test output with splitted commit 287 Test output with splitted commit
472 $ hg update 471597cad322 474 $ hg update 471597cad322
473 abort: hidden revision '471597cad322'! 475 abort: hidden revision '471597cad322'!
474 (use --hidden to access hidden revisions; successors: 337fec4d2edc, f257fde29c7a) 476 (use --hidden to access hidden revisions; successors: 337fec4d2edc, f257fde29c7a)
475 [255] 477 [255]
476 $ hg update --hidden 'min(desc(A0))' 478 $ hg update --hidden 'min(desc(A0))'
479 updating to a hidden changeset 471597cad322
477 0 files updated, 0 files merged, 0 files removed, 0 files unresolved 480 0 files updated, 0 files merged, 0 files removed, 0 files unresolved
478 working directory parent is obsolete! (471597cad322) 481 working directory parent is obsolete! (471597cad322)
479 (use 'hg evolve' to update to its tipmost successor: 337fec4d2edc, f257fde29c7a) 482 (use 'hg evolve' to update to its tipmost successor: 337fec4d2edc, f257fde29c7a)
480 483
481 Test output with lots of splitted commit 484 Test output with lots of splitted commit
749 $ hg update de7290d8b885 752 $ hg update de7290d8b885
750 abort: hidden revision 'de7290d8b885'! 753 abort: hidden revision 'de7290d8b885'!
751 (use --hidden to access hidden revisions; successors: 337fec4d2edc, f257fde29c7a and 2 more) 754 (use --hidden to access hidden revisions; successors: 337fec4d2edc, f257fde29c7a and 2 more)
752 [255] 755 [255]
753 $ hg update --hidden 'min(desc(A0))' 756 $ hg update --hidden 'min(desc(A0))'
757 updating to a hidden changeset de7290d8b885
754 0 files updated, 0 files merged, 0 files removed, 0 files unresolved 758 0 files updated, 0 files merged, 0 files removed, 0 files unresolved
755 working directory parent is obsolete! (de7290d8b885) 759 working directory parent is obsolete! (de7290d8b885)
756 (use 'hg evolve' to update to its tipmost successor: 337fec4d2edc, f257fde29c7a and 2 more) 760 (use 'hg evolve' to update to its tipmost successor: 337fec4d2edc, f257fde29c7a and 2 more)
757 761
758 Test output with folded commit 762 Test output with folded commit
966 $ hg update 471f378eab4c 970 $ hg update 471f378eab4c
967 abort: hidden revision '471f378eab4c'! 971 abort: hidden revision '471f378eab4c'!
968 (use --hidden to access hidden revisions; successor: eb5a0daa2192) 972 (use --hidden to access hidden revisions; successor: eb5a0daa2192)
969 [255] 973 [255]
970 $ hg update --hidden 'desc(A0)' 974 $ hg update --hidden 'desc(A0)'
975 updating to a hidden changeset 471f378eab4c
971 0 files updated, 0 files merged, 1 files removed, 0 files unresolved 976 0 files updated, 0 files merged, 1 files removed, 0 files unresolved
972 working directory parent is obsolete! (471f378eab4c) 977 working directory parent is obsolete! (471f378eab4c)
973 (use 'hg evolve' to update to its successor: eb5a0daa2192) 978 (use 'hg evolve' to update to its successor: eb5a0daa2192)
974 $ hg update 0dec01379d3b 979 $ hg update 0dec01379d3b
975 working directory parent is obsolete! (471f378eab4c) 980 working directory parent is obsolete! (471f378eab4c)
976 (use 'hg evolve' to update to its successor: eb5a0daa2192) 981 (use 'hg evolve' to update to its successor: eb5a0daa2192)
977 abort: hidden revision '0dec01379d3b'! 982 abort: hidden revision '0dec01379d3b'!
978 (use --hidden to access hidden revisions; successor: eb5a0daa2192) 983 (use --hidden to access hidden revisions; successor: eb5a0daa2192)
979 [255] 984 [255]
980 $ hg update --hidden 'desc(B0)' 985 $ hg update --hidden 'desc(B0)'
986 updating to a hidden changeset 0dec01379d3b
981 1 files updated, 0 files merged, 0 files removed, 0 files unresolved 987 1 files updated, 0 files merged, 0 files removed, 0 files unresolved
982 working directory parent is obsolete! (0dec01379d3b) 988 working directory parent is obsolete! (0dec01379d3b)
983 (use 'hg evolve' to update to its successor: eb5a0daa2192) 989 (use 'hg evolve' to update to its successor: eb5a0daa2192)
984 990
985 Test output with divergence 991 Test output with divergence
1011 user: test 1017 user: test
1012 date: Thu Jan 01 00:00:00 1970 +0000 1018 date: Thu Jan 01 00:00:00 1970 +0000
1013 summary: ROOT 1019 summary: ROOT
1014 1020
1015 $ hg update --hidden 'desc(A0)' 1021 $ hg update --hidden 'desc(A0)'
1022 updating to a hidden changeset 471f378eab4c
1016 0 files updated, 0 files merged, 0 files removed, 0 files unresolved 1023 0 files updated, 0 files merged, 0 files removed, 0 files unresolved
1017 working directory parent is obsolete! (471f378eab4c) 1024 working directory parent is obsolete! (471f378eab4c)
1018 (use 'hg evolve' to update to its successor: fdf9bde5129a) 1025 (use 'hg evolve' to update to its successor: fdf9bde5129a)
1019 $ hg amend -m "A2" 1026 $ hg amend -m "A2"
1020 2 new content-divergent changesets 1027 2 new content-divergent changesets
1291 $ hg update 471f378eab4c 1298 $ hg update 471f378eab4c
1292 abort: hidden revision '471f378eab4c'! 1299 abort: hidden revision '471f378eab4c'!
1293 (use --hidden to access hidden revisions; diverged) 1300 (use --hidden to access hidden revisions; diverged)
1294 [255] 1301 [255]
1295 $ hg update --hidden 'desc(A0)' 1302 $ hg update --hidden 'desc(A0)'
1303 updating to a hidden changeset 471f378eab4c
1296 0 files updated, 0 files merged, 0 files removed, 0 files unresolved 1304 0 files updated, 0 files merged, 0 files removed, 0 files unresolved
1297 working directory parent is obsolete! (471f378eab4c) 1305 working directory parent is obsolete! (471f378eab4c)
1298 (471f378eab4c has diverged, use 'hg evolve --list --content-divergent' to resolve the issue) 1306 (471f378eab4c has diverged, use 'hg evolve --list --content-divergent' to resolve the issue)
1299 1307
1300 Test output with amended + folded commit 1308 Test output with amended + folded commit
1513 $ hg update 471f378eab4c 1521 $ hg update 471f378eab4c
1514 abort: hidden revision '471f378eab4c'! 1522 abort: hidden revision '471f378eab4c'!
1515 (use --hidden to access hidden revisions; successor: eb5a0daa2192) 1523 (use --hidden to access hidden revisions; successor: eb5a0daa2192)
1516 [255] 1524 [255]
1517 $ hg update --hidden 'desc(A0)' 1525 $ hg update --hidden 'desc(A0)'
1526 updating to a hidden changeset 471f378eab4c
1518 0 files updated, 0 files merged, 1 files removed, 0 files unresolved 1527 0 files updated, 0 files merged, 1 files removed, 0 files unresolved
1519 working directory parent is obsolete! (471f378eab4c) 1528 working directory parent is obsolete! (471f378eab4c)
1520 (use 'hg evolve' to update to its successor: eb5a0daa2192) 1529 (use 'hg evolve' to update to its successor: eb5a0daa2192)
1521 $ hg update --hidden 0dec01379d3b 1530 $ hg update --hidden 0dec01379d3b
1531 updating to a hidden changeset 0dec01379d3b
1522 1 files updated, 0 files merged, 0 files removed, 0 files unresolved 1532 1 files updated, 0 files merged, 0 files removed, 0 files unresolved
1523 working directory parent is obsolete! (0dec01379d3b) 1533 working directory parent is obsolete! (0dec01379d3b)
1524 (use 'hg evolve' to update to its successor: eb5a0daa2192) 1534 (use 'hg evolve' to update to its successor: eb5a0daa2192)
1525 $ hg update 0dec01379d3b 1535 $ hg update 0dec01379d3b
1526 0 files updated, 0 files merged, 0 files removed, 0 files unresolved 1536 0 files updated, 0 files merged, 0 files removed, 0 files unresolved